[lld] r194909 - Simplify. No functionality change.

Rui Ueyama ruiu at google.com
Fri Nov 15 17:01:35 PST 2013


Author: ruiu
Date: Fri Nov 15 19:01:35 2013
New Revision: 194909

URL: http://llvm.org/viewvc/llvm-project?rev=194909&view=rev
Log:
Simplify. No functionality change.

Modified:
    lld/trunk/lib/ReaderWriter/Native/WriterNative.cpp

Modified: lld/trunk/lib/ReaderWriter/Native/WriterNative.cpp
URL: http://llvm.org/viewvc/llvm-project/lld/trunk/lib/ReaderWriter/Native/WriterNative.cpp?rev=194909&r1=194908&r2=194909&view=diff
==============================================================================
--- lld/trunk/lib/ReaderWriter/Native/WriterNative.cpp (original)
+++ lld/trunk/lib/ReaderWriter/Native/WriterNative.cpp Fri Nov 15 19:01:35 2013
@@ -380,8 +380,7 @@ private:
   }
 
   // add references for this atom in a contiguous block in NCS_ReferencesArrayV1
-  uint32_t getReferencesIndex(const DefinedAtom& atom, unsigned& count) {
-    count = 0;
+  uint32_t getReferencesIndex(const DefinedAtom& atom, unsigned& refsCount) {
     size_t startRefSize = _references.size();
     uint32_t result = startRefSize;
     for (const Reference *ref : atom) {
@@ -392,11 +391,8 @@ private:
       nref.addendIndex = this->getAddendIndex(ref->addend());
       _references.push_back(nref);
     }
-    count = _references.size() - startRefSize;
-    if ( count == 0 )
-      return 0;
-    else
-      return result;
+    refsCount = _references.size() - startRefSize;
+    return (refsCount == 0) ? 0 : result;
   }
 
   uint32_t getTargetIndex(const Atom* target) {





More information about the llvm-commits mailing list